ABC’s Contractor Confidence Rebounds; Construction Backlog Indicator Flat in August

by | Sep 13, 2022 | ABC | 0 comments

WASHINGTON, Sept. 13—Associated Builders and Contractors reports today that its Construction Backlog Indicator remained unchanged at 8.7 months in August, according to an ABC member survey conducted Aug. 22 to Sept. 7. The reading is a full month higher than in August 2021.
